How Electrostatic Precipitators increase Air top quality in PVC Manufacturing

PVC manufacturing normally involves processes that launch major quantities of smoke and fumes, particularly from PVC foaming ovens. These emissions incorporate a variety of pollutants that can degrade air good quality Otherwise effectively managed. Electrostatic precipitators Participate in a vital position in mitigating these emissions. They operate by charging particles within the exhaust gasoline, causing them to adhere to plates in the precipitator, correctly eradicating them from your air stream. this method not merely captures the pollutants and also allows for the Restoration of beneficial components like oil. The efficiency of ESPs can achieve nearly ninety five%, as evidenced by systems like Individuals developed by Kleanland, which have been utilized effectively in PVC leather-based output smoke filtration. The integration of ESPs in PVC producing services considerably boosts the air good quality by cutting down harmful emissions. By doing so, these units aid develop a safer and cleaner Operating setting for employees and contribute to broader environmental security initiatives. Additionally, companies can gain economically in the Restoration and reuse of captured products, for example oils and solvents, more underscoring the worth of ESPs in industrial air filtration.

Comparing ESP technologies to Other Air Filtration Methods in PVC generation

In relation to air filtration in PVC output, various systems are available, such as bag filters, scrubbers, and cyclones. Each of those methods has its personal established of advantages and constraints. one example is, bag filters are powerful at removing dust but may demand Repeated replacement and routine maintenance, leading to better operational expenditures. Scrubbers, Alternatively, are adept at handling gases and fumes but can eat significant quantities of water and produce waste sludge that needs disposal. Electrostatic precipitators provide a distinct advantage over these strategies by combining substantial efficiency with small servicing demands. contrary to bag filters, ESPs do not count on Bodily obstacles to seize particles, which minimizes dress in and tear and extends the lifespan of the products. Furthermore, ESPs usually do not make wastewater like scrubbers, creating them a far more sustainable option for amenities searching to attenuate environmental effects. the flexibility of ESPs to handle a wide array of particle measurements and compositions can make them notably suited to the numerous emissions present in PVC creation.
